Mikel Oyarzabal, captain of Real Sociedad, officially announced his commitment to stay with his club and his lack of desire to transfer to Barcelona. This complicates the Catalan club’s efforts to replace Robert Lewandowski during the summer transfer window. The 29-year-old player, whose contract runs until 2028, confirmed that he is happy at Sociedad and wants to continue his career with the team, after scoring 15 goals in La Liga last season and achieving great accomplishments with the Spanish national team. Barcelona had considered Oyarzabal as a key option to strengthen their attack, but the player’s clear stance prevents him from moving, forcing the club’s management to look for other options.
